What will the weather be like in Custer?
Although weather is just one factor, it can really affect your travel plans, especially when you're planning an extended stay in Custer.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 22°C, while the coldest months are February and December, with an average of -2°C. The snowiest months in Custer are February, October, January and March, with each month seeing an average of 18 cm of snowfall.
